Weather in August

August continues the trend of hot, summer conditions in Ewarton, Jamaica. Matched only by July, the maximum temperature recorded is 31.7°C (89.1°F). The strong sunshine, matched by the highest average temperature of the year, renders the month hot and steamy. Despite the peak summer heat, rainfall figures take a small downward trend. These factors contribute to a rather airy, sultry ambiance during August in Ewarton.

Temperature

Ewarton's peak temperatures tend to occur in July and August, with an average high-temperature of 31.7°C (89.1°F).

Heat index

The heat index for August is appraised at a blisteringly hot 42°C (107.6°F). Extra precautions are necessary,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are plausible outcomes. Extended activity could lead to heatstroke.
In terms of the heat index, values are set with light wind and shade conditions in mind. Heat index values might soar by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ees with exposure to direct sunshine.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', is a measure of how hot it feels when the actual air humidity is factored in. Factors such as metabolic variations, being pregnant, and physical activity can impact an individual's weather perception. The sun, when shining directly, can have a significant impact on the perceived temperature, increasing the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ular importance for children. Children frequently do not comprehend the need for rest and hydration. Thirst is an advanced stage of dehydration - staying hydrated, especially during extended physical exercises, is essential.
The natural cooling mechanism in humans involves perspiration, where the evaporation of sweat balances out excessive warmth. When there is an excess of moisture in the atmosphere, the efficiency of the evaporation process is lessened, leading to less efficient body cooling and a sensation of overheating. Heat-related challenges, like dehydration, can be anticipated when body heat isn't managed effectively.

Humidity

March, July and August, with an average relative humidity of 77%, are the least humid months.

Rainfall

In Ewarton, during August, the rain falls for 24.9 days and regularly aggregates up to 80mm (3.15") of precipitation. In Ewarton, during the entire year, the rain falls for 265.1 days and collects up to 806mm (31.73")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 12h and 43min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:46 and sunset at 18:42.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 05:53 and sunset at 18:23 EST.

Sunshine

With an average of 11h of sunshine, August has the most sunshine of the year in Ewarton.

UV index

May through August and October,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: In August, a daily UV index of 7 turns into the following recommendations:
Eschew overexposure. Those with light skin may suffer burns in fewer than 20 minutes. Seek shade and limit direct S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ak, but be aware that not all shade structures provide complete sun protection. Your best bet for sun defense on the face, eyes, and neck is a hat with a wide brim.
